function filter($txt,$int_type){
$var = $_GET[$txt];
if($var==''){
$var = $_POST[$txt];
}
$var = trim($var);
if($int_type==0){
if($var==''){
return 0;
}else{
return (float) $var;
}
}else{
$var = eregi_replace("update "," ",$var);
$var = eregi_replace("insert "," ",$var);
$var = eregi_replace("select "," ",$var);
$var = eregi_replace("drop "," ",$var);
}
return $var;
}
function getHtmlUrl($txt){
return str_replace(".php",".htm",$txt);
}
function cutStr($txt,$len){
return mb_substr($txt, 0,$len, 'utf-8') . "...";
}
function delHtml($a){
return preg_replace('/<(.*?)>/','',$a);
}
function GetParentToHidden(){
$tmp_par = "";
foreach($_GET as $key=>$target){
if($key != "account" && $key != "password" && $key != "do_login" && $key != "u" && $key != "page" && $key != "int_Var"){
$tmp_par.="\n";
}
}
foreach($_POST as $key=>$target){
if($key != "account" && $key != "password" && $key != "do_login" && $key != "u" && $key != "page" && $key != "int_Var"){
$tmp_par.="\n";
}
}
return $tmp_par;
}
function fixsql($txt,$int_type){
$var = $_GET[$txt];
if($var==''){
$var = $_POST[$txt];
}
$var = trim($var);
if($int_type==0){
if($var==''){
return 0;
}else{
return (int) $var;
}
}
return $var;
}
function DateDiff($date1,$date2,$unit=""){
switch ($unit){
case 's':
$dividend = 1;
break;
case 'i':
$dividend = 60;
break;
case 'h':
$dividend = 3600;
break;
case 'd':
$dividend = 86400;
break;
default:
$dividend = 86400;
}
$time1 = strtotime($date1);
$time2 = strtotime($date2);
if ($time1 && $time2) {
return (float)($time1 - $time2) / $dividend;
}
return false;
}
function del($path,$file_name){
if($file_name!="" && $file_name!="no.gif"){
$file_path = realpath($path . "/" . $file_name);
if(file_exists($file_path)){
unlink($file_path);
}
}
}
function addZero($txt,$num){
if($txt==0){
$txt = "";
}else if($txt != ""){
if($num==3){
if($txt<10){
return "00" . $txt;
}else if($txt < 100){
return "0" . $txt;
}
}else if($num == 2){
if($txt<10){
return "0" . $txt;
}
}
}
return $txt;
}
function redirect($url){
echo "";
exit;
}
function getUpDownSql($t_name){
$tmp = "";
if($t_name <> ""){
$t_name .= ".";
}
$realDate = date('Y-m-d',time());
$tmp = $t_name . "upordown=1 and ((" . $t_name . "uptime<='" . $realDate . "' and " . $t_name . "downtime='') ";
$tmp .= "or (" . $t_name . "uptime='' and " . $t_name . "downtime='') or (";
$tmp .= $t_name . "uptime='' and " . $t_name . "downtime>'";
$tmp .= $realDate . "') or (" . $t_name . "uptime<='" . $realDate . "' and " . $t_name . "downtime>'" . $realDate . "'))";
return $tmp;
}
function getRealDate(){
return date('Y-m-d',time());
}
function getRandNum(){
return time() . rand(1000,2000);
}
function mysendmail($to_email,$from_email,$from_name,$subject,$morningbody,$smtp_server,$smtp_user,$smtp_pass) {
$smtpserver = $smtp_server;
$smtpserverport =25;
$smtpusermail = $from_email;
$smtpemailto = $to_email;
$smtpuser = $smtp_user;
$smtppass = $smtp_pass;
$mailsubject = $subject;
$mailbody = $morningbody;
$mailtype = "HTML";
##########################################
$smtp = new smtp($smtpserver,$smtpserverport,true,$smtpuser,$smtppass);
$smtp->debug = FALSE;//TRUE;//
$smtp->sendmail($smtpemailto,$from_name,$smtpusermail,$mailsubject, $mailbody, $mailtype);
}
?>
4CLEAN, THE BEST FOR CLEANING.
| |
 |
| |
| require('_smoothmenu.php');?> |
| |
| |
|
|